Email Workflows & Automations
You can use OneDrive to automate email workflows, such as sending automatic emails when files are dropped into a shared folder. This can be achieved by creating a flow that triggers when files are added to the folder.
For example, a user created a flow to send an email with attached files when one or multiple files are dropped into a OneDrive folder. However, the flow was sending multiple emails instead of one, likely due to a loop in the flow.

Colligo Integrates Outlook 365
You can stay in Outlook 365 and access the OneDrive for Business folder hierarchy. This integration allows you to work more efficiently without having to switch between apps.
Colligo's integration with Microsoft's OneDrive for Business reduces the time it takes knowledge workers to view and file content, and share files.
With Colligo Email Manager, you can upload emails and/or attachments from Outlook into a particular folder within OneDrive for Business. This is a huge time-saver, as you can file emails and attachments directly from Outlook without having to manually move them.
You can preview, file, and edit OneDrive files, as well as directly send emails as a link or an attachment directly from Outlook. This level of integration makes it easy to work with content and emails, even when you're not connected to the internet.
Here are some key benefits of Colligo's integration with Outlook 365:
- Stay in Outlook 365 and access the OneDrive for Business folder hierarchy
- Upload emails and/or attachments from Outlook into a particular folder within OneDrive for Business
- Preview, file, and edit OneDrive files, as well as directly send emails as a link or an attachment directly from Outlook
- Pin document libraries or folders from within OneDrive for Business as ‘favorite’ locations for quick access from Outlook

Scam
Scammers are particularly interested in email accounts because they're often connected to other accounts, making it easy to hijack them all.
These scammers use fake emails with a subject like "One Drive" to trick you into sharing your email and password.
The emails claim a file was shared with you, but it's just a ruse to get you to click on a link.
If you click the "ViewOneDriveDocument" button, you'll be redirected to a Google Forms page that asks for your email and password.
This page is not a genuine sign-in page, and it even warns you not to submit your password through Google Forms.
If you've already tried to log in through the fake page, change your email account's login credentials immediately, and update all associated accounts.
Stolen email accounts can lead to financial loss, serious privacy issues, and even identity theft.
